#f08348 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f08348 is composed of 94.1% red, 51.4%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45.4% magenta, 70%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 21.1 degrees, a saturation of 84.8% and a lightness of 61.2%. #f08348 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ff90 with #e10700. Closest websafe color is: #ff9933.

#f08348 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f08348 has RGB values of R:240, G:131,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.45, Y:0.7,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15762248.

Shades and Tints of #f08348
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100701 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.
